CBSE Class 11 Curriculum

So, the CBSE Physics Term 1 Syllabus has a total of 6 units. Additionally, the table shows the CBSE Physics unit, as well as the marks assigned to each unit.

Time: One and half hours

Max Marks: 35

Unit No.Name of UnitNo. of PeriodsMarks
Unit–IPhysical World and Measurement620
 Chapter–1: Physical World
 Chapter–2: Units and Measurements
Unit-IIKinematics16
 Chapter–3: Motion in a Straight Line
 Chapter–4: Motion in a Plane
Unit–IIILaws of Motion10
 Chapter–5: Laws of Motion
Unit–IVWork, Energy and Power1215
 Chapter–6: Work, Energy and Power
Unit–VMotion of System of Particles and Rigid Body16
 Chapter–7: System of Particles and Rotational Motion
Unit-VIGravitation8
 Chapter–8: Gravitation
 Total6835

CBSE Class 11 Physics Syllabus – Term 2

Time: 2Hrs

Max Marks: 35

Additionally, in the table following table, students can see the CBSE 11 Physics curriculum for Term 2.

UnitName of UnitNo. of PeriodsMarks
Unit–VIIProperties of Bulk Matter2223
 Chapter–9: Mechanical Properties of Solids
 Chapter–10: Mechanical Properties of Fluids
 Chapter–11: Thermal Properties of Matter
Unit–VIIIThermodynamics10
 Chapter–12: Thermodynamics
Unit–IXBehaviour of Perfect Gases and Kinetic Theory of Gases08
 Chapter–13: Kinetic Theory
Unit–XOscillations and Waves2312
 Chapter–14: Oscillations
 Chapter–15: Waves
Total6335

Chemistry Class 11 Syllabus

So, the term 1 class 11 syllabus is as follows:

Unit No.Unit NameNo. of PeriodsMarks
Unit ISome Basic Concepts of Chemistry1011
Unit IIStructure of Atom12
Unit IIIClassification of Elements and Periodicity in Properties0604
Unit IVChemical Bonding and Molecular Structure1406
Unit VRedox Reactions0405
Unit VIHydrogen04
Unit VIIOrganic Chemistry: Some Basic Principles and Techniques109
 Total6035

The Term 2 syllabus is as follows:

Unit No.Unit NameNo. of PeriodsMarks
Unit VStates of Matter: Gases and Liquids0915
Unit VIChemical Thermodynamics14
Unit VIIEquilibrium12
Unit Xs -Block Elements0511
Unit XIp -Block Elements09
Unit XIIIHydrocarbons109
 Total5935

Maths Class 11 Syllabus

So, the CBSE Maths syllabus for class 11 is divided into five units. Additionally, the units, number of periods, and marks allotted for term 1 are listed in the table below. So, the Term 1’s Maths theory paper is worth 40 points, and the internal assessment is worth 10 points.

Term 1 Syllabus

No.UnitsMarks
I.Sets and Functions11
II.Algebra13
III.Coordinate Geometry06
IV.Calculus04
V.Statistics and Probability06
 Total Theory40
 Internal Assessment10

Term 2 Syllabus

Additionally, the CBSE Maths Syllabus for class 11 is divided into five units. Additionally, the units, number of periods, and marks allotted for term 2 are listed in the table below. Moreover, the term 2 Maths theory paper is worth 40 points, and the internal assessment is worth 10 points.

No.UnitsMarks
I.Sets and Functions (Cont.)08
II.Algebra (Cont.)11
III.Coordinate Geometry (Cont.)09
IV.Calculus (Cont.)06
V.Statistics and Probability (Cont.)06
 Total Theory40
 Internal Assessment10

Biology Class 11 Syllabus

Additionally, in the table below, students can see the CBSE Class 11 Biology Syllabus mark distribution by term.

Theory
UnitsTerm IMarks
IDiversity of Living Organisms: Chapter – 1, 2, 3 and 415
IIStructural Organisation in Plants and Animals: Chapter – 5 and 708
IIICell: Structure and Function: Chapter – 8 and 912
UnitsTerm IIMarks
IIICell: Structure and Function: Chapter – 1005
IVPlant Physiology: Chapter – 13, 14 and 1512
VHuman Physiology: Chapter – 17, 18, 19, 20, 21 and 2218
 Total Theory (Term – I and Term – II)70
 Practicals Term – I15
 Practicals Term – II15
 Total100

Business Studies Class 11 Syllabus

Theory: 40 Marks

Duration: 90 Minutes

Additionally, CBSE Class 11 Business Studies Syllabus assists learners in their exam preparation. Also, students can refer to the syllabus to have a better understanding of the marks distribution. 

UnitsTerm 1- MCQ Based Question PaperPeriodsMarks
Part AFoundations of Business  
1Evolution and Fundamentals of Business1816
2Forms of Business Organisations20
3Public, Private and Global Enterprises1014
4Business Services14
5Emerging Modes of Business0510
6Social Responsibility of Business and Business Ethics08
 Total7540
 Project Work (Part 1) 10

Theory: 40 Marks

Duration: 2 Hours

UnitsTerm 2 Subjective Question PaperPeriodsMarks
Part BFinance and Trade  
7Sources of Business Finance2820
8Small Business and Entrepreneurship Development16
9Internal Trade2220
10International Business04
 Total7040
 Project Work (Part-2) 10
